Publisher name | Arcadia (Mastertronic) | |||
Birth year | 1987 | |||
Year of death | 1992 | |||
Mother country | USA | |||
Notes | Label that produced conversions of Mastertronic's Arcadia coin-ops, which were based on the A500. Notably, Arcadia's Super Select System, a multiplay coin-op, came in two formats, Sports Simulation & Arcade Action, and contained 5 games each. Reportedly there was a 10 game machine that combined the two formats also. Arcadia also released at least 3 standalone coin-ops (Aaargh!, Roadwars, Rockford). | |||
Main company | Mastertronic | |||
